Most security stacks grow one purchase at a time. A phishing incident buys an email gateway, an audit finding buys an endpoint agent, a compliance question buys a password vault, and three years later nothing talks to anything else. RevBits builds the five pieces as one suite, which is the reason we picked them over a point tool for any single line item.
We bring RevBits into a conversation when a client is handling regulated data, is stuck in a customer security review, has an insurer asking questions they cannot answer, or has an audit finding with a deadline attached. If the requirement is soft, we say so and we do not make the introduction.
Five products, one platform
- Email Security
- A cloud email gateway aimed at phishing and targeted attacks, rather than the bulk spam most mail platforms already handle.
- Endpoint Security
- Endpoint detection and response with real-time protection across systems, reporting into the same platform as the rest.
- Privileged Access Management
- Privileged accounts, passwords, keys and certificates in one place. Usually the fastest way to close an access-control finding.
- Deception Technology
- Decoys that surface an intruder who is already inside and moving laterally.
- Zero Trust Networking
- Verification-based network access, for teams retiring a flat network or a legacy VPN.
Best fit
Healthcare, financial services, and any team being asked security questions by a customer, an insurer, or an auditor.
